Biography of Dwayne Johnson
Dwayne Douglas Johnson, famously known as “The Rock,” was born on May 2, 1972, in Hayward, California. He’s the son of Ata Johnson (born Feagaimaleata Fitisemanu) and Rocky Johnson, a professional wrestler. Growing up, Dwayne was exposed to the world of wrestling early on, which eventually played a major role in shaping his career.
Before becoming a household name in WWE and later in Hollywood, Dwayne played college football at the University of Miami. Unfortunately, injuries cut his football dreams short, so he turned to wrestling, following in his father’s footsteps. His charisma and athletic prowess quickly made him a fan favorite in the World Wrestling Federation (WWF), now known as WWE, during the iconic “Attitude Era.”
From there, Dwayne transitioned into acting, landing roles in major films like *The Mummy Returns*, *Fast & Furious* franchise, and *Jumanji* series. He’s also a successful businessman, owning his own production company, 7 Bucks Productions. As of 2021, he was ranked as one of the highest-paid actors in the world, earning around $50 million for his role in *Red Notice*.

Does Dwayne Johnson Have a Twin Brother?
So, back to the big question: Does Dwayne Johnson have a twin brother? The short answer is no. Despite what you might have heard or read online, Dwayne is not a twin. He has two sisters — Wanda and Donna — but no brothers, twin or otherwise.
It’s possible that the confusion comes from the fact that Dwayne’s father, Rocky Johnson, was a wrestler, and his grandfather, Peter Maivia, was also a wrestler. So when people hear “wrestling family,” they might assume that there could be another sibling in the mix who also wrestled. But that’s just not the case here.
